| METHODS : Male rats ( 350 450 g ) were randomized to treatment with control ( 5 % human serum albumin , HSA , n = 6 ) or test solution ( 9 % polymerized hemoglobin , PHB , n = 6 ) . ^^^ Following a right nephrectomy , the left renal artery was perfused with 4 ml of HSA or PHB at 37 degreesC . ^^^ RESULTS : Treatment with PHB resulted in lower Cr ( 1 . 2 + / 0 . 23 mg / dl vs 3 . 26 + / 0 . 60 mg / dl , P < 0 . 01 ) and BUN ( 60 . 5 + / 12 . 7 mg / dl vs 151 + / 20 . 2 mg / dl , P < 0 . 01 ) at 72 h compared to HSA controls . ^^^ PHB treated kidneys had less evidence of histologic damage compared to those in the HSA group ( 0 . 75 + / 0 . 11 vs 2 . 50 + / 0 . 64 , P < 0 . 05 ) . ^^^ |
